Professor Prinny
Burning or Poison can work as long as the Shedinja doesn't have any other status effect.

So apparently we get a free Celebi using Pokémon Bank anytime before September 30, 2014. Cool stuff.

Serebii wrote:

The Celebi is Level 10 when downloaded and has Recover, Heal Bell, a new move called Hold Back, which acts like False Swipe, and Safeguard. it is downloaded by accessing the Pokémon Link option that will appear on the main menu of Pokémon Bank

Serebii wrote:

Pokémon Bank Requirements

It has been announced by Nintendo of Japan that, before you can download Pokémon Bank onto your Nintendo 3DS, you need to set up a Nintendo Network ID. This ID system was implemented on the Nintendo 3DS last week with the latest system update and can be the same Nintendo Network ID as registered on the Wii U. This can be done when you load up the eShop or in the System Settings of the 3DS console.
